Just days after Hillary Clinton lost the Presidential elections, rumors have surfaced claiming that Chelsea Clinton will run for congress in the 2018 midterm elections.
Nita Lowey currently represents NYC’s 17th Congressional District and has represented it since 1989. It includes sections of Rockland and Westchester counties and also includes Chappaqua, where the Clintons live. At 79, she’s expected to retire, which would make way for Chelsea campaigning to take her place.
This comes at a time when the Democratic Party is restructuring after what many political pundits considered an upset win by Trump.
